5-1B. RIPPLE AND NOISE CHECK .
a. An AC Voltmeter (-hp- Model 331A) will be
required for this operation. Connect AC Volt­
meter to Model 467A output. Set
0.003 V.
b.
Set Model 467A to SUPPLY ± 20; VOLTS ADJ
fully CW(+20. 00 V). Short Model 467A INPUT.
c. AC Voltmeter should read less than 1. 77 mV
rmS (5 mV peak-to-peak ) .
d. Rotate AMPLIFIER/SUPPLY switch to AM­
P LIFIER XlO.
e. AC Voltmeter should still read less than 1.77
mV rms (5 mV peak-to-peak) .

5-20. POWER SUPPLY VOLTAGE CHECKS.

a. A DC Voltmeter (-hp- Model 3440A/3444A)
will be required for this check.
b. Connect DC Voltmeter between point desig­
nated in Table 5-5 and circuit ground. Volt­
meter should display readings as indicated.
